Step 1
Open an Internet Explorer web browser.
-
Step 2
Choose the "Internet Options" menu item. It's located under the Tools menu.
-
Step 3
Locate and click the "Content" tab. In Internet Explorer 7, the "Content" tab is the fourth tab from the left. It may vary depending on which Internet Explorer version you're using.
-
Step 4
Click the "Enable" button. It will open a window entitled Content Advisor. The Content Advisor window has several tabs by which you can control the content you wish to receive. You may approve content by ratings under the "Ratings" tab. Adjust the slider to the left or right to determine how much of a particular rating category your users can see. Or, you can manually insert the approved sites under the "Approved Sites" tab. Under the "General" tab you can enable the "Supervisor" option and select a password to control the content. However, if you're a pro with Internet Explorer, you can modify the "Advanced" options.
-
Step 5
Click "OK" to save and apply your settings.
